Hoi,
Ik heb in een excel bestand in een cel een serverlocatie die refereert naar een .jpg file.
Nu wil ik via een macro de werkelijke foto ophalen en weergeven in dat excel bestand op een vooraf bepaalde plaats.
Hiervoor heb ik volgende code gevonden:
Private Sub Macro()
Dim lokatie As String
lokatie = Range("Sheet1!$C$3")
Range("Sheet1!C7").Select
ActiveSheet.Pictures.Insert(lokatie).Select
Selection.ShapeRange.Width = 168
Selection.ShapeRange.Height = 153
End Sub
Tot dusver werkt dit prima.
MAAR: als de serverlocatie incorrect, onvolledig of niet ingevuld is, start de VBA debugger elke keer ik de macro laat lopen.
Welke code moet ik toevoegen aan deze macro, opdat incorrecte/onvolledige serverlocatie genegeerd wordt ipv de debugger op te starten ?
Alvast bedankt !
PS: deze vraag heb ik ook gesteld op http://office.webforums.nl/viewtopic.php?p=214262#214262
Ik heb in een excel bestand in een cel een serverlocatie die refereert naar een .jpg file.
Nu wil ik via een macro de werkelijke foto ophalen en weergeven in dat excel bestand op een vooraf bepaalde plaats.
Hiervoor heb ik volgende code gevonden:
Private Sub Macro()
Dim lokatie As String
lokatie = Range("Sheet1!$C$3")
Range("Sheet1!C7").Select
ActiveSheet.Pictures.Insert(lokatie).Select
Selection.ShapeRange.Width = 168
Selection.ShapeRange.Height = 153
End Sub
Tot dusver werkt dit prima.
MAAR: als de serverlocatie incorrect, onvolledig of niet ingevuld is, start de VBA debugger elke keer ik de macro laat lopen.
Welke code moet ik toevoegen aan deze macro, opdat incorrecte/onvolledige serverlocatie genegeerd wordt ipv de debugger op te starten ?
Alvast bedankt !
PS: deze vraag heb ik ook gesteld op http://office.webforums.nl/viewtopic.php?p=214262#214262
Laatst bewerkt: